Calibration is all about making sure that a tool measures up to a known standard. For hand taps, this means checking that the pitch, diameter, and other key dimensions are spot &#8211; on. When a tap is calibrated, it&#8217;s more likely to cut clean threads, fit properly into nuts or other threaded parts, and last longer.<\/p>\n<p>Now, you might be thinking, &quot;Do I really need to calibrate my hand taps? Can&#8217;t I just use them straight out of the box?&quot; Well, it depends. New hand taps usually come pretty close to the right specifications. But there are a few reasons why calibration can still be a good idea.<\/p>\n<p>First off, manufacturing processes aren&#8217;t perfect. Even the best factories can have a bit of variation in the production of hand taps. A tiny difference in the pitch or diameter can lead to problems when you&#8217;re trying to cut threads. For example, if the pitch is off, the threads might not fit together properly, which can cause parts to come loose or not work at all.<\/p>\n<p>Secondly, wear and tear can affect the accuracy of hand taps. Every time you use a tap, it gets a little bit of wear on the cutting edges. Over time, this can change the dimensions of the tap. If you&#8217;re using a tap for high &#8211; precision work, like in the aerospace or medical industries, even a small amount of wear can be a big deal.<\/p>\n<p>Another factor to consider is the type of material you&#8217;re working with. Different materials can put different stresses on hand taps. Harder materials, like stainless steel or titanium, can cause more wear on the tap compared to softer materials like aluminum. If you&#8217;re constantly working with hard materials, you&#8217;ll probably need to calibrate your taps more often.<\/p>\n<p>So, how do you calibrate hand taps? Well, there are a few ways. One common method is to use a thread gauge. A thread gauge is a simple tool that you can use to check the pitch and diameter of the tap. You just slide the gauge onto the tap and see if it fits properly. If it doesn&#8217;t, then the tap might need to be adjusted or replaced.<\/p>\n<p>There are also more advanced calibration methods. Some companies use specialized equipment, like coordinate measuring machines (CMMs), to get very accurate measurements of the tap&#8217;s dimensions. These machines can measure the tap to within a few micrometers, which is super precise.<\/p>\n<p>But calibration isn&#8217;t just about checking the dimensions. It&#8217;s also about making sure the tap is in good condition. You need to check for things like chipped cutting edges, cracks, or other damage. If a tap is damaged, it won&#8217;t cut threads properly, no matter how well &#8211; calibrated it is.<\/p>\n<p>Now, let&#8217;s talk about the benefits of calibrating hand taps. The most obvious benefit is that it improves the quality of the threads you cut. When a tap is calibrated, it cuts clean, accurate threads that fit together perfectly. This means less rework, fewer rejects, and better &#8211; functioning parts.<\/p>\n<p>Calibration also extends the life of your hand taps. By catching wear and damage early, you can take steps to repair or replace the tap before it becomes completely useless. This can save you money in the long run, &#8217;cause you won&#8217;t have to buy new taps as often.<\/p>\n<p>In addition, calibrated hand taps can improve your productivity. When you&#8217;re using a well &#8211; calibrated tap, you can work faster and more efficiently. You don&#8217;t have to worry about the tap not cutting properly or causing problems with the threads.<\/p>\n<p>But there are also some challenges when it comes to calibrating hand taps. One of the biggest challenges is the cost. Calibration equipment can be expensive, especially the more advanced stuff like CMMs. And if you don&#8217;t have the right equipment, you might have to send your taps to a professional calibration service, which can also be costly.<\/p>\n<p>Another challenge is the time it takes to calibrate the taps. Calibration isn&#8217;t a quick process, especially if you&#8217;re using a detailed method like a CMM. You have to take the taps out of production, measure them, and then make any necessary adjustments. This can slow down your workflow, especially if you have a lot of taps to calibrate.<\/p>\n<p>So, what&#8217;s the bottom line? Do hand taps need to be calibrated? In most cases, the answer is yes. While it might cost some time and money, the benefits of calibration far outweigh the drawbacks.
